Odd Man Out Question 4:
Five jumbled up sentences (labelled 1, 2, 3, 4 and 5), related to a topic, are given below. Four of them can be put together to form a coherent paragraph. Identify the odd sentence and key in the number of that sentence as your answer.
1. The discovery of multiple Neanderthal skeletons, some exhibiting severe injuries that had healed, suggested sophisticated care-giving within their communities.
2. Shanidar Cave, located in the Zagros Mountains of Iraq, holds immense historical significance due to its extraordinary Neanderthal archaeological findings.
3. Recent genetic analysis of Neanderthal DNA has provided new insights into their interbreeding with early modern humans.
4. Perhaps most famously, evidence from 'Shanidar IV,' the 'flower burial,' hints at symbolic thinking or ritualistic practices, though this interpretation remains debated.
5. These remains provided crucial evidence challenging the long-held perception of Neanderthals as primitive brutes, instead revealing complex social behaviors.
Answer (Detailed Solution Below) 3
Odd Man Out Question 4 Detailed Solution
- Let's analyze each sentence to determine its relation to the central topic. The core of the paragraph is about the archaeological findings at Shanidar Cave and what they revealed about Neanderthal behavior, specifically challenging the "primitive brute" perception.
- Sentence 2: "Shanidar Cave, located in the Zagros Mountains of Iraq, holds immense historical significance due to its extraordinary Neanderthal archaeological findings." This sentence introduces Shanidar Cave as a significant site for Neanderthal archaeology. This is a strong opening sentence for a paragraph focused on the cave.
- Sentence 1: "The discovery of multiple Neanderthal skeletons, some exhibiting severe injuries that had healed, suggested sophisticated care-giving within their communities." This sentence details a specific type of finding from Shanidar (implied by the context set by S2) that contributes to a more complex understanding of Neanderthals.
- Sentence 4: "Perhaps most famously, evidence from 'Shanidar IV,' the 'flower burial,' hints at symbolic thinking or ritualistic practices, though this interpretation remains debated." This sentence provides another specific, well-known example of findings from Shanidar Cave that further support the idea of complex Neanderthal behavior.
- Sentence 5: "These remains provided crucial evidence challenging the long-held perception of Neanderthals as primitive brutes, instead revealing complex social behaviors." This sentence summarizes the overall significance of the findings mentioned in sentences 1 and 4 (and generally those from Shanidar Cave), tying them back to the broader re-evaluation of Neanderthals. The phrase "These remains" refers directly to the discoveries discussed.
- These four sentences (2, 1, 4, 5) form a coherent paragraph about the archaeological importance of Shanidar Cave and how its discoveries (skeletons, 'flower burial') revolutionized our understanding of Neanderthal social behavior. A logical order would be 2-1-4-5.
- Sentence 3: "Recent genetic analysis of Neanderthal DNA has provided new insights into their interbreeding with early modern humans." While this sentence is about Neanderthals and new discoveries, it focuses on genetic analysis and interbreeding, which is a separate field of study and topic compared to the archaeological findings from Shanidar Cave that reveal social behaviors and challenge the "primitive brute" perception. It shifts the focus from archaeological evidence of social complexity to genetic evidence of biological interaction.

Which of the following is not a planet?
Answer (Detailed Solution Below)
Odd Man Out Question 7 Detailed Solution
Download Solution PDFThe correct answer is 'More than one of the above'.
Key Points
- A planet is generally defined as a celestial body that orbits around a star (the sun in the case of our solar system), is spherical in shape, and has cleared its orbit of other debris.
- Mercury is a planet. It's the smallest planet and closest to the sun in our solar system.
- Pluto, once considered the ninth planet of our solar system, was demoted to a dwarf planet status in 2006.
- The International Astronomical Union (IAU) downgraded the status of Pluto to that of a dwarf planet because it did not meet the three criteria the IAU uses to define a full-sized planet. Therefore, in the current classification, it is not considered a full-fledged planet.
- The Moon is not a planet. It's a satellite, specifically the Earth's only natural satellite.
Therefore, the correct answer is Option 4.
